Step 1 – Pick a Winning Fashion Niche (2026 Trends)
Why fashion and apparel are still profitable in 2026
Fashion is emotional, visual, and repeat-purchase. People buy new outfits every month. Margins on dropshipping and print-on-demand can reach 40–60%. And TikTok’s algorithm loves showing clothing to the right people — for free.
Sub-niche examples (avoid “general clothing store”)
| Niche | Example store concept | Why it works in 2026 |
|---|---|---|
| Streetwear | Minimalist hoodies + caps | Gen Z and Gen Alpha dominate spending |
| Minimalist fashion | Neutral colors, clean cuts | Quiet luxury trend continues |
| Gym wear / activewear | Seamless leggings, cropped tops | Home workouts + gym culture still huge |
| Modest fashion | Long dresses, layering pieces | Underserved, high loyalty |
| Y2K / vintage style | Baggy jeans, baby tees, butterfly prints | TikTok nostalgia cycle |
Free trend research methods (no paid tools needed)
1. TikTok
- Search: #fashiontiktok, #streetwearcheck, #modestoutfit
- Look for videos with 50k–500k views (not just viral mega-hits)
- Check comments: “Where can I buy this?” = demand signal
2. Pinterest Trends (free)
- Go to pinterest.com/trends
- Compare “Y2K outfits” vs “minimalist fashion” by month
- Pinterest users plan purchases → leading indicator
3. Google Trends (free)
- Enter “activewear sets” vs “oversized hoodies.”
- Set to “Past 12 months” → see rising vs falling
- Filter by country (US, UK, Canada, Australia)
Quick niche validation checklist (10 minutes)
- At least 3 dropshipping or print-on-demand suppliers offer products in this niche
- You can generate 10+ organic content ideas (try asking ChatGPT)
- Real people on TikTok are already asking, “Where to buy this?”

Step 4 – Add Products Without Buying Inventory
Dropshipping explained in simple terms
Customer buys from you → you order from supplier → supplier ships directly to customer. You never touch the product.
Print-on-demand for fashion stores
You design (or use AI to generate graphics) → print-on-demand company prints on blank t-shirts or hoodies → ships to customer. Perfect for unique fashion brands.
How to find suppliers (zero upfront, no minimum orders)
| Model | Best for | Free supplier apps |
|---|---|---|
| Dropshipping | Jewelry, bags, basic apparel | DSers (AliExpress) |
| Print-on-demand | Custom t-shirts, hoodies, mugs | Printful, Printify (free tiers) |
Product selection tips for beginners
- ✅ Pick 15–20 products max (not 500)
- ✅ Focus on 1 category (e.g., hoodies + sweatpants)
- ✅ Use supplier photos for launch (replace later with your own photos)
- ❌ Avoid cheap, fragile items (phone cases, cheap jewelry → high return rates)
Example first product set for a streetwear store:
- Oversized hoodie (black)
- Oversized hoodie (grey)
- Minimalist cap
- Cropped t-shirt
- Parachute pants

Step 7 – Set Up Payments and Checkout
Shopify Payments and PayPal setup
Shopify Payments (recommended)
- No third-party transaction fees
- Payouts in 2–3 business days
- Requires basic business info (name, address — tax ID can come later)
PayPal Express Checkout
- Enable inside the Shopify Payments section
- Increases customer trust
How payouts work
Customer pays → funds hold for approximately 3–7 days (for new stores) → released to your bank account. You don’t pay suppliers until after you’ve been paid (if using dropshipping).
No upfront payment required, explained
- You don’t pre-fund inventory
- You don’t pay Shopify until the trial ends
- You don’t pay for traffic (using organic methods)
You will pay suppliers when you place their orders, but that happens after a customer pays you. Zero cash needed upfront.

SEO basics for Shopify products (free traffic forever)
| Action | How to do it for free |
|---|---|
| Product title | “Men’s Oversized Hoodie – Black” (not just “Hoodie”) |
| Meta description | 150 characters with keywords + a clear benefit |
| Alt text on images | “black oversized hoodie streetwear front view” |
| Blog post (1–2 per month) | “How to style oversized hoodies in 2026” → links to your products |
SEO takes 2–3 months to start working, but once it does, traffic is free and predictable forever.
